French Civil CodeIn force
Chapter II: Use and habitation

Article 632

He who has a right of habitation in a house may live there with his family, even if he had not been married at the time the right was given to him.

French Code of civil procedureIn force
Title I: Agreement-based mediation and conciliation

Article 1536

Any natural or legal person may refer a matter to the judicial conciliator instituted by the decree of 20 March 1978 relating to judicial conciliators, without any formality.
